Output 37cb93247d24e5356cda0528f8f6f80e03bb3ea5b0e6cf2367fd5c18badb30c8:0

value
560615
script pubkey
OP_0 OP_PUSHBYTES_20 c53f7589f60e5f54a69e72f10cb0dc8ce286606d
address
bc1qc5lhtz0kpe04ff57wtcsevxu3n3gvcrdredmzw
transaction
37cb93247d24e5356cda0528f8f6f80e03bb3ea5b0e6cf2367fd5c18badb30c8
spent
true